The B.E./B.Tech fees in PSN College of Engineering and Technology usually range from INR 50,000 to INR 1,00,000 for a year on the basis of the course and category of admission. The following shall be tuition fees, laboratory fees, library fees, and other administrative charges. Admission under government quota is presumably cheaper, whereas it is relatively expensive for management quota admissions. It's worth noting that the fee structure changes every year, so it would be wise to visit the official website or get in touch with the college to know the most relevant and current fee structure available for courses.

The B.E./B.Tech fees at Gurukula Kangri Vishwavidyalaya are: General/OBC candidates the fee structure shall be 1,43,000 INR in the first year and 1,23,000 INR for the second to fourth years; SC/ST candidates shall be 83,000 INR in the first year and 63,000 INR for the second to fourth years. Additional fees: The admission fee is 5000 INR, the exam fee is 2000 INR, the library fee is 1500 INR. Hostel fees: 60,000-80,000 INR annually. Total 4-year fee: 5,24,000-6,44,000 INR. The fee for pursuing a B.E./B.Tech course at SSBT's College of Engineering and Technology, Jalgaon is different for each course and the mode of admission. For students seeking admission in government quota seats, the charges for tuition fees are generally in the region of INR 70,000 per annum. Since private quota fees are expected to be much higher, these may be pegged approximately at about INR 1,20,000 in a year. These figures are subject to annual changes to a small extent, therefore, it is prudent to refer to the college's website or contact the college for the latest precise and reliable fees structure.
